Visiting Scottsdale, Arizona With Kids

June 20, 2013

Earlier this month, we traveled with Maggie & Alex to Scottsdale, Arizona & stayed at the Four Seasons Scottsdale at Troon North. My husband & I have traveled a lot with the girls, since Maggie was just a few months old, but we have always had family & friends along with us. For the first time ever, we were planning a trip for just the 4 of us. Scottsdale is somewhere Tom & I have always wanted to go, but weren’t sure if we wanted to take the kids while they are so little. We are so glad we decided to go when we did! The girls loved it & we had a wonderful, memorable family vacation.

We stayed at the Four Seasons Scottsdale At Troon North. We could not have picked a better place for our family. The hotel is very accommodating to families’ catering even to the smallest guests (our girls are 3 & 21 months).


10 Reasons why we loved visiting the Four Seasons Scottsdale with our 2 littles girls:

 

 

 1. The Wading Pool: The Four Seasons Scottsdale has a few pools to enjoy. We spent most of our time at the children’s wading pool. This pool was perfect for Maggie & Alex. They could walk around the entire pool safely. They spend the days splashing & playing with pool toys. Along with a kid sized pool, there were kid sized lounge chairs & tables too!

2. Beds: The crib that was brought into the room for Alex was awesome. It was soft, big enough for her (at 21 months) & she slept great. For Maggie, our room had a pull out couch that she slept on. It was perfect because during the day it could stay closed, so the girls had room to run around, & then we could pull it out at night for her to sleep.

 

3. Proof: This was the ultimate family restaurant. Proof, an American canteen, serves homestyle comfort food. It’s located on the resort. They have nostalgic toys to entertain the kids while they wait for their food & their kids meals are fantastic. The meals come with 2 sides, which then gives the kids 3 options on their plates. They have bright colored melamine dinnerware, just like what we use at home. We’ve had plenty of dinning out experiences where the kids eat nothing. This was not the case at Proof: they loved the kid sized plates with plenty to choose from. Then for dessert, they had a chance to visit the ice cream counter!

 

 4. Robes: The kid size bath robes were a big hit with Maggie & Alex. They are were so soft & the girls rushed to put them on as soon as they got out of the bath. They were pretty bummed when we got home, took a bath & didn’t have the plush bathrobes to hop into!

5. Baby Gear: One thing that I dislike in a hotel room is having to put the diapers into the small trash cans in the room. My kids can stink up a hotel room after the first hour of our stay. That’s why I was thrilled that I could request a diaper genie for the room! They also provided an extra mini fridge for us to keep sippy cups, milk, etc for the kids. The Four Seasons Scottsdale will also provide a microwave,  high chair for the room & will even childproof the room for you!

6. Kids Eat Free: At the Four Seasons Scottsdale, kids 4 & under eat free (certain rules apply). This was great for our family!

 

7. Family Movie Night: The Four Seasons Scottsdale has wonderful family activities. During our stay, they had one of their “Dive in Movies”. Starting at sundown, one of the cabanas at the pool turns into a movie screen. Families gather around the pool & on floats in the pool & enjoy a movie. This was Maggie’s favorite part of the trip. She asks me everyday “Do you remember when we got to swim at night & watch tv in a pool?”.

 


8. In-Casita Dinning:
After many meals out, it was nice to have breakfast delivered to the room one morning. We could eat on our hotel room balcony in our pajamas & enjoy the view. It was relaxing & the girls got a kick out of eating in the hotel room.


9. Kids For All Seasons:
It gets very hot in Scottsdale. We did most activities early in the morning & then went right to the pool. We also liked to try & have the kids spend a little time out of the sun. We spent time each day at Kids For All Seasons. Kids For All Seasons is the Four Seasons children’s camp. for ages 5-12, but you can attend the activities & playroom with your kids if they are under 5. The playroom was awesome. There were so many toys, my girls didn’t want to leave. It was the perfect place to cool off & play during the day.

 

 

10. SO much to see! There was so much for us to walk around & see at the Four Seasons Scottsdale. We saw lizards, bugs, birds & cacti of every shape & size. There were beautiful paths to walk on & explore. Maggie & Alex loved walking around the resort with us, discovering new things.

We truly had an amazing family vacation. The Four Seasons Scottsdale At Troon North is definitely somewhere we will return as a family. It was the perfect place to bring little ones & someday we hope to return when they are older & experience the resort again!
